Papers presented at a conference at Aix-en-Provence, 23-24 April 2010. Contents: 1) De l'apparition et de l'expansion des groups de specialistes endogames en Afrique : essai d'explication (T. TAMARI); 2) L'endogamie des forgerons dans les monts Mandara: origine et reification d'un concept nomade (O. LANGLOIS); 3) Smith and society: patterns of articulation in the Mandara mountains (Northeast Nigeria and Northern Cameroon) (N. DAVID & J. STERNER); 4) Les forgerons des Toubou: vers un nouveau regard sur l'endogamie des forgerons en Afrique (C. BAROIN); 5) The Bassar chiefdom in the context of theories of political economy (P. DE BARROS); 6) Entre four et forge ou jusqu'a quel point efficacite magique et savoir technique sont-ils conciliables ? (Bassar du Togo) (S. DUGAST); 7) Lecture historique, economique et spatiale de la production siderurgique: les sites de reduction du village de Wol (pays dogon, Mali) (C. ROBION-BRUNNER); 8) Woody resource exploitation for iron metallurgy of the Fiko Tradition: Implications for the environmental history of the Dogon Country, Mali (B. EICHHORN); 9) Analyse de la repartition spatiale de bas fourneaux d'un territoire siderurgique au sud-ouest du Niger (4e-14e siecle ap. J.-C.) (R. GUILLON et al.); 10) Donnees archeologiques et ethnographiques: une confrontation parfois difficile. L'exemple du district siderurgique de Markoye (Burkina Faso) (J.-M. FABRE); 11) La paleometallurgie du fer dans la province du Bam (Burkina Faso): identite des acteurs et mobilite des techniques (S. N. BIRBA); 12) Bilan de recherche sur la siderurgie directe dans la province du Bulkiemde au Burkina-Faso: un exemple d'approche pluridisciplinaire (H. KIENON & K. TIMPOK); 13) The Bloom Refining Technology in Ufipa, Tanzania (1850-1950) (E. C. LYAYA, B. B. MAPUNDA, & T. REHREN); 14) The role of iron in foraging societies of northern Namibia in the 15th to the 20th century AD 209 (E. KOSE); 15) Technological Variability in Iron Metallurgy: the case of two Oromo traditional smelting sites in Wollega, Ethiopia (T. BURKA); 16) La reduction metallurgique: des sens aux savoirs transmis (P. ANDRIEUX); 17) Anthropologie, ethnohistoire, ethnoarcheologie et archeologie du fer: quelle place accorder au discours des acteurs ? (A. GALLAY).
